Foundation crack repair services involve identifying and addressing cracks that develop in a building’s foundation. These services typically include a thorough inspection to assess the severity and location of cracks, followed by appropriate repair methods such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or mudjacking. The goal is to restore the structural integrity of the foundation, preventing further damage and ensuring the stability of the property. Professional contractors use specialized techniques and materials designed to fill and seal cracks, helping to maintain the foundation’s strength over time.
Cracks in foundations can lead to a range of problems if left unaddressed, including u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and increased vulnerability to water intrusion. Over time, these issues may result in more significant structural damage, mold growth, or compromised safety of the property. Foundation Crack Repair Cost - The typical cost for foundation crack repair can range from $500 to $3,000, depending on the size and severity of the cracks. Smaller cracks may cost less, while larger or more complex repairs tend to be more expensive.
Material and Method Expenses - Repair costs vary based on the materials used, such as epoxy injections or carbon fiber reinforcement. Expect prices to range from $400 to $2,500 for different repair techniques and materials.
Location and Accessibility - The cost can increase if the foundation is difficult to access or if the repair requires excavation. Typical expenses in these cases may range from $1,000 to $4,000 or more.
Additional Services and Inspection - Some providers include inspection fees or additional services like waterproofing, which can add $200 to $1,000 to the overall cost. Contact local pros to get det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ation cracks?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How do professionals typically repair foundation cracks? Repair methods often involve sealing cracks with specialized epoxy or polyurethane injections, and in some cases, underpinning or reinforcement may be recommended.
Are all foundation cracks a cause for concern? Not all cracks indicate serious issues; hairline cracks are common, but larger or expanding cracks may require assessment and repair by a professional.
What factors contribute to foundation cracking? Factors include so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ction, or settling over time, which can lead to cracks in the foundation.
